Role Overview
We are seeking an enthusiastic Coach to join our Academy team. The postholder will lead on the individual, group, and team planning of the football pathway within the U13 & U14 Cell. Ensuring each player has an up-to-date and relevant individual development plan.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ead U13 and U14 age group on match and training days.
- Lead on day release planning
- To plan, create, and evaluate coaching sessions as scheduled in the weekly plan. To review SCFC core sessions with colleagues and update accordingly.
- To plan and deliver training sessions that prioritise an individual player development focus within SCFC core sessions.
- To independently source and review video clips of individuals and groups with reference to the player's individual learning objectives in liaison with the analysis department.
- Provide a health check / update on coaching cell operations in each 9/18/27/36/45-week coaching meeting.
- Provide impactful feedback to players to support progression.
- Manage the trialist's who enter the coaching cell providing suitable evaluation and feedback during the signing / exit policy.
- Ensure the Football intelligence platform (FIP) is completed and up to date.
- Liaise with parents of players to create a collaborative approach.
- Ensure the individual development of players is always prioritised within planning.
- Deliver consistent up to date communication with the Academy Manager and Head of Coaching surrounding the journey of the players and have tracking/plans upto date for player reviews.
- Align coaches and the coaching programme to the club's coaching and playing philosophy.
- Oversee the team planning and theming per mesocycle.
- Connect and collaborate with other cell coaches and wider MDT surrounding training support and team selections.
- Connect with Youth Phase staff surrounding training support and team composition.
- Observe and prioritise individual player development within training and fixtures.
- Support Youth Phase coaches with all aspects of the role, including coaching delivery to enhance best practice.
- Monitor and evaluation of all players in the Youth Phase for the succession planning process.
- Identify areas for development and work closely with the Academy Senior Management Team and Multi-Disciplinary teams to ensure necessary performance standards are met and developed.
- Monitor and drive the key development processes within the Youth Development Phase to ensure progression is being made.
Essential
- First aid qualified (EFAIF level 2)
- UEFA A License
- Advanced Youth Award
- FA Safeguarding & Child Protection
- Coaching methodology
Desirable
- UEFA A- License
- Sports Coaching/Science or Sports Management Degree
- Experience of analysis and review platforms
